How to request/add an adjustment through a front end account


1. Hello! Today we're going to discuss how to add an adjustment through your official's account. The first thing you will do is come to the official's account page on the website and log in.

2. Then you will proceed to the adjustments page.

3. As you can see here, we've got some adjustments that have already been submitted to the association. We're just going to come up here to the top button and click on "Add adjustment".

4. First, we're going to pick the club that this is applicable to, in this case, my RAMP Demo Association. If you have multiple clubs that you work for, you will use the "Club" drop down menu to select the one you want to apply the adjustment to.

5. Next, we can filter the games by using the search controls, we can narrow down the game by Zone, Division, Arena or by date.

6. Click into the "Zone" dropdown menu to select a zone.

7. Click into the "Division" dropdown menu to select a division.

8. Now, I can't recall which zone I worked this game for, so I'm going to leave all the filters set to "All" and just click on the "View" button.

9. Once you've narrowed it down by filters and clicked view, below, a new area will open with a "Games" dropdown menu.

10. I'm going to check the games dropdown menu and use it to select this game to from the 14th.

11. Once you have selected a game, at this point you will see the association has added in pre-generated adjustments. They have an additional amount that is paid for a tournament. An additional flat amount that is paid for between 50 and 100 km which were driven to get to the game, and then they also have a $50 food per diem.

12. I can also look at the flat gas adjustment, where it allows me to enter in my kilometres driven.

13. You can use the arrow tools on the side of the KM Driven field to enter in the amount, or, it's faster if you click onto the field and just enter your amount.

14. In this instance, I can enter 20 km, which is just short of the pre-generated adjustment.

15. Below the KM Driven field, I can see the adjustment amount here would be $80.

16. Today, however, I want to input a custom adjustment and this adjustment is not a pre-generated adjustment that is already in the system. My assignor told me to enter an adjustment for $10, which I will enter into the amount field.

17. In the "Reason" field, I am going to enter my reason, which is I was the short notice replacement for another official, who got sick at the last minute.

18. I'm just going to type in short notice replacement.

19. And then I will click "Submit".

20. You can see here, that I had another game that I was also a short notice replacement for an official that was sick. And so I have these two that are pending. Adjustments that you add to the system will show pending until the assignors had a chance to look at it, and then at that point, they'll either approve or deny the request. You'll be able to see which administrator or assignor approved or denied the adjustment that you made in the system.

21. That's it. All you have to do is wait for them to approve or deny. Now, we can check out where it shows the adjustments in relation to your pay breakdown, and we'll click on "Game Breakdown" on the left side menu.

22. Enter in the date range that the game took place - the game that you requested the adjustment for, using the date fields at the top of the page.

23. Click "View Game Breakdown"

24. Here you can see the approved adjustments that were added to this pay period - these were previous adjustments I had entered in the system for past games, as the ones I just entered for the demo have not been approved yet.

25. Below the pay breakdown, you can see the adjustment request date, the amount and the reason.
